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

Low-code IoT (Internet of Things)

Low-code IoT (Internet of Things) is an approach to developing IoT applications using a minimal amount of manual coding, often relying on visual development tools, pre-built components, and reusable templates for the creation, integration, management, and analysis of IoT systems. This approach is especially relevant in the context of the increasingly complex and interconnected nature of IoT devices, which necessitates systems capable of handling vast amounts of data, supporting diverse connectivity protocols, and offering advanced security and privacy features.

The emergence of low-code IoT platforms, such as AppMaster, has enabled organizations to achieve a more efficient, cost-effective, and agile development process, drastically reducing time-to-market while maintaining a high level of quality and adaptability. According to recent surveys conducted by Gartner, Inc., nearly 65% of application development by 2024 will be done using low-code platforms like AppMaster.

Low-code IoT platforms are characterized by a series of distinguishing features that set them apart from traditional, code-intensive application development frameworks. These include:

  • Visual Modeling: Low-code IoT platforms empower developers to build and design applications using a graphical, drag-and-drop interface. This allows for rapid prototyping and iterative refinement of application functionality and user experience. In the case of AppMaster, the platform provides visual BP Designers for backend, web, and mobile applications to define data models, business logic, REST API and WSS endpoints, and UI components.
  • Pre-built Components and Templates: These platforms offer a vast library of pre-built, reusable components, and templates that cover a wide range of features, such as sensor data collection, device management, analytics, and security, allowing developers to assemble applications more efficiently. AppMaster also generates real applications ensuring that customers can use their compiled applications with minimal hassle.
  • Seamless Integration: Low-code IoT platforms facilitate seamless integration with external systems and services, including databases, analytics platforms, and third-party APIs. AppMaster applications can work with any PostgreSQL-compatible database as the primary database and demonstrate impressive scalability for a variety of enterprise and high-load use cases.
  • Platform Independence: Applications developed using low-code IoT platforms are typically platform-independent, providing the flexibility to work across various environments and IoT ecosystems. AppMaster generates web applications using the Vue3 framework and generates mobile applications using Kotlin and Jetpack Compose for Android and SwiftUI for iOS, ensuring compatibility across different platforms.
  • Security and Compliance: Low-code IoT platforms are designed to help organizations build secure applications that adhere to industry standards and regulations, implementing robust security mechanisms at architectural, coding, and deployment levels. This enables organizations to minimize risk and safeguard critical data, both in transit and at rest.
  • Deployment and Maintenance: Low-code IoT solutions simplify the process of application deployment, scaling, and maintenance, often offering built-in mechanisms for automating these tasks and generating necessary documentation, like swagger/open API, for server endpoints and database schema migration scripts. AppMaster continuously generates applications from scratch, effectively eliminating any technical debt that might accumulate over time.

In summary, low-code IoT is an innovative approach to IoT application development that leverages efficient and user-friendly development tools and methodologies for a faster, more cost-effective, and scalable process. By employing the features and capabilities of platforms like AppMaster, organizations stand to benefit from a simplified yet powerful development experience, allowing them to bring IoT solutions to market quicker and with reduced effort. As the world of connected devices continues to grow and evolve, low-code IoT platforms will play an increasingly prominent role in shaping the way we create and manage these complex digital ecosystems.

Related Posts

How to Choose the Right Health Monitoring Tools for Your Needs
How to Choose the Right Health Monitoring Tools for Your Needs
Discover how to select the right health monitoring tools tailored to your lifestyle and requirements. A comprehensive guide to making informed decisions.
The Benefits of Using Appointment Scheduling Apps for Freelancers
The Benefits of Using Appointment Scheduling Apps for Freelancers
Discover how appointment scheduling apps can significantly boost freelancers' productivity. Explore their benefits, features, and how they streamline scheduling tasks.
The Cost Advantage: Why No-Code Electronic Health Records (EHR) Are Perfect for Budget-Conscious Practices
The Cost Advantage: Why No-Code Electronic Health Records (EHR) Are Perfect for Budget-Conscious Practices
Explore the cost benefits of no-code EHR systems, an ideal solution for budget-conscious healthcare practices. Learn how they enhance efficiency without breaking the bank.
GET STARTED FREE
Inspired to try this yourself?

The best way to understand the power of AppMaster is to see it for yourself. Make your own application in minutes with free subscription

Bring Your Ideas to Life